“…Among these, the modulation method is the key to determining the final performance of the MMC circuit and to affecting the charging and discharging of the module capacitor [5]. The studies relating to modulation can be generally divided into four types, namely, nearest voltage level (NVL) [6], look-up table [7], [8], carrier phase shifted pulse width modulation (CPSPWM) [9]- [11], and phase disposition pulse width modulation (PDPWM) [5], [12]. The NVL method is a widely used modulation approach for MMC circuits because of its simple executing process [6].…”
